为什么医生不遵循临床实践指南? 一个改善的框架

概括
医生遵守临床实践指南受到各种因素的限制,包括意识,同意和外部障碍. 了解这些障碍对于改善医疗保健质量和医生实践至关重要.
科学领域:
- 医疗实践和质量改善
- 医疗服务研究 医疗服务研究
- 医生行为研究研究医生行为研究.
背景情况:
- 临床实践指南旨在规范护理,但往往无法改变医生的行为.
- 对于影响医生采用指南的具体因素的理解有限.
研究的目的:
- 系统地审查和识别阻碍医生遵守临床实践指南的障碍.
主要方法:
- 在MEDLINE,ERIC和HealthSTAR数据库 (1966-1998) 中进行了全面的文献搜索.
- 选择了76项相关研究,并对报告的指南遵守障碍进行了分析.
- 障碍物根据它们对医生的知识,态度和行为的影响而分类.
主要成果:
- 在76项研究中的120项调查中,确定了293个潜在障碍.
- 常见的障碍包括缺乏意识 (46),熟悉 (31),同意 (33),自我有效性 (19),结果预期 (8),克服实践惯性 (14),以及外部绩效障碍 (34).
- 大多数调查 (58%) 只关注一种障碍.
结论:
- 遵守指南的障碍是特定于环境的,限制了改进策略的概括性.
- 这一审查为诊断不遵守的原因和制定有针对性的干预措施提供了一个框架.
- 需要进一步的研究来解决医生遵守指南的多面性质.

Obedience
According to obedience research, we may harm others under the forceful pressures of an authority figure (Milgram, 1974). How about if the inappropriate orders were delivered with less force? The increasing interdependence between nurses and physicians compelled Hofling and his colleagues to explore nurses’ reactions to a potentially harmful medical request made by the perceived authority figure, the doctor (Hofling, Brotzman, Dalrymple, Graves, & Pierce, 1966). Methods of Documentation VI: Case Management Model
The case management model is a multidisciplinary approach that involves healthcare professionals from diverse disciplines, such as physicians, nurses, therapists, social workers, and pharmacists, working collaboratively to address the various needs of patients. Each healthcare professional brings unique expertise and perspectives, contributing to a more comprehensive understanding of the patient's condition and tailoring treatment plans accordingly.

Ethical Standards I
The American Nurses Association (ANA) created and implemented the first nationally accepted Code of Ethics for Nurses with Interpretive Statements. The Code of Ethics is a living document regularly updated by the ANA and establishes an ethical standard that is non-negotiable for nurses in all roles and settings.
